Output 959a6cc3f01398335b6d0cf3ef2801fed3657b1cf7a80cfd45de400469e79130:19

value
11517182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c9f90bd76dbb529343f07050f555386052641d OP_EQUAL
address
394BwD5498adxecveuNuC2gTpya2AsoNqC
transaction
959a6cc3f01398335b6d0cf3ef2801fed3657b1cf7a80cfd45de400469e79130
spent
true